Double Car Door Installation
The 16-foot double openings in Redland’s split-levels and larger colonials present specific challenges. Original torsion springs rated for 10,000 cycles fail in 4–5 years here due to high daily use from I-270 commuters — that’s 4–6 cycles per day, burning through spring life far faster than the manufacturer’s 7–10 year assumption. When we install a new double door, we spec higher-cycle springs (20,000–30,000 cycles) to match actual Redland usage patterns. Double car installations typically range $1,200–$2,200, with steel being the practical choice given our freeze-thaw cycles and summer humidity.

Steel Doors
Steel dominates our Redland installations for straightforward reasons: it handles Montgomery County’s temperature swings without warping, resists the humidity-driven rust that destroys unprotected spring coils and tracks, and insulates well against the hard freezes that drop into the teens each winter. Clopay and Amarr steel lines offer 24-gauge to 25-gauge options with or without insulation backing. For Redland’s attached garages — common in the ZIP 20855 townhome stock — we typically recommend insulated steel to buffer living-space temperature and reduce energy load.

Common Garage Door Installation Problems We See in Redland Homes
- Original torsion springs failing prematurely. Redland’s I-270 commuter households cycle doors 4–6 times daily, exhausting 10,000-cycle springs in 4–5 years instead of 7–10. We see the aftermath every January: snapped springs, dropped doors, cars trapped in driveways at 6 a.m.
- Ice storms welding seals to concrete. Montgomery County’s mid-Atlantic winters bring frequent ice storms that freeze door bottom seals to the slab. When the opener tries to pull against that bond, metal-fatigued torsion springs snap overnight — the region’s single most common emergency garage door call.
- Missing permits on single-to-double conversions. Homeowners switching from an older single door to a wider modern double often miss Montgomery County’s building permit requirement for structural rough opening alterations. We’ve been called in after other contractors’ installations failed final inspection, leaving the homeowner with a door they can’t legally operate.
- Pre-1993 openers without safety sensors. Many Redland homes still run original chain-drive openers that predate federal auto-reverse requirements. These can’t be grandfathered in during a new installation — replacement is mandatory, adding $250–$550 to the project but eliminating liability and injury risk.

Hard freezes and ice storms stress every component. Cold thickens lubricant, forcing motors to work harder; ice-welded seals create binding loads that trip safety mechanisms or burn out drive gears. Original chain-drive openers from the 1980s–1990s lack the torque compensation and safety sensors of modern systems, making them particularly vulnerable.
